Re: Official Thread Of Free To Air Satellite Tv (part 4) by GeorgeD1(m): 2:00pm On Nov 04, 2009 |
olofofo: @olofofo, Here is what you need for Lagos: Latitude= 6° 27' 11" N Longitude= 3° 23' 45" E Magnetic declination= 3° 14' WEST Declination is NEGATIVE Meaning that the difference between magnetic south and true south=3° 14' or 3.1° Therefore, true south on your compass will be (180° - 3.1° ) = 176.9° |

@ Olofofo. Here is another practical approach. If u know the azimuth value of W3A- that's an example of a satellite that is almost true south--at my end its 182.4 deg true azimuth, and the magnetic azimuth is 184 deg. Now if u face directly to the W3A, using ur already W3A-receiving dish as a guide, hold your compass in that direction, and read what it gives u. With this I think your compass should give a value u can now compare what George-D and Enitan gave. good luck and feed back. |

Re: Official Thread Of Free To Air Satellite Tv (part 4) by isomadtech(m): 12:58pm On Nov 05, 2009 |
@pitondez if you can get somebody that can help you to search Alaba mkt, you could probably get one but if you can't get it you can use the Alcad for the purpose. you have got it right by creating the design for ten houses per box. if you are connecting each of the houses to the box directly, you must use big amp in the box and this will also give the signal the opportunity to travel to the next box, if not, then you might split the signal in the box to two and use one to power the signal to the next box and use the other to link the houses close to the box. the major thing there is that the RG11 cable will help to carry the signal farther than the RG6. you can contact me on 08035726658 or 07026208919. |

Re: Official Thread Of Free To Air Satellite Tv (part 4) by FMarshal2(m): 5:36pm On Nov 05, 2009 |
This is my Mini-Bud C-band Summer Project. The Dish is 1.20M Dish, pointing at Galaxy 16 @ 99.0°W. I got all the strong transponders, but wasn't able to receive all the C-band frequencies on that bird, because of the dish size limitation. It was nice to get C-band signals with a 1.2M dish. Mind you, it was just for fun. If you have a 1.20M dish and a C-band LNB, maybe you could try it. You also need the Conical Scala to make (boost) the signal stable. Enjoy the photos:
